1. Understanding Florida's Legal Landscape

Florida's legal system has unique rules regarding personal injury claims, including comparative negligence and strict time limits for filing a lawsuit, known as the statute of limitations. Comparative negligence allows for damages to be distributed among parties based on their degree of fault. This means that even if you are partially responsible for your accident, you may still be eligible to recover some damages from other at-fault parties.

5. Compensation You May Be Entitled To

When filing a personal injury claim in Florida, you may seek compensation for various damages incurred due to your accident or injury. These can include med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, emotional distress, and loss of enjoyment of life among others. 1. Understanding Personal Injury Law

Personal injury law encompasses regulations that provide relief to individuals who have been harmed due to someone else's negligence or wrongful conduct. It covers a broad range of incidents from road accidents involving cars, trucks, and boats to unfortunate situations resulting in wrongful death claims. The primary goal is to restore the injured party, as much as possible, to their pre-incident state through financial compensation.

3. Valuing Your Claim 

Determining the value of your claim is complex and involves various factors including medical expenses, lost wages due to inability to work, pain and suffering, and long-term disability or disfigurement if applicable.
